The acclaimed Henschke family, foundation members of Australia’s First Families of Wine, was one of the pioneering families of South Australia when Johann Christian Henschke migrated from Silesia (Germany in 1841). Each generation has contributed to the legend with fourth-generation Cyril Henschke pioneering varietal, single-vineyard wines in the 1950s, most famously Mount Edelstone and Hill of Grace Shiraz. Fifth-generation winemaker Stephen and his viticulturist wife Prue have won many awards for their talent, innovation, and integration of vineyard and winery. They lead the way with environmental, biodynamic, and organic principles. Henschke wines are handcrafted and deeply personal, reflecting the unique terroir of vineyards: the wine names tell either a personal story of the family or the cultural history of their region.

The riesling takes its name from a local landmark, Peggy’s Hill, at the top of the range between Eden Valley and Keyneton. Produced from selected traditional Henschke Eden Valley growers, whose vines are up to 50 years old, growing in low-vigour ancient Cambrian soils at around 500m altitude. The Eden Valley riesling displays exceptional varietal and regional characteristics.

The lead up to the 2024 season in the Eden Valley was characterised by significant rainfall in June, followed by a dry spring. Variable fruit set and frost impacted the yield potential, however rain at the beginning of December assisted canopy and berry development and good soil moisture levels supported vine growth well into January. The mild summer weather eventually warmed up and dried out, with some short bursts of heat, leading into a warm, dry autumn, which delivered optimal maturity and ripeness in the fruit. Our focus on canopy health in the vineyard was vital and this attention to detail resulted in pure and intense primary fruit characters in our white wines, with stunning acidity and freshness.

Review

Pale colour. Fragrant bitter lemon, hint grapefruit aromas with herb oil notes. Fresh lemon, lime, grapefruit flavours, fine loose knit bitter textures, attractive mid palate volume and fresh long crunchy mouthwatering acidity. Finishes bittersweet. Textural and high tensile with very good density and flow. Could benefit from a few years of bottle age. Drink now – or keep for a while (2034+).

Pale lime and lemon tones in the glass. Fragrant with white flowers, lime zest and chalk dust. Bright and fresh, zippy acidity lifts lemon and lime fruits across the tongue, hints of floral sweetness show towards the finish but a chalky grip ensures it has a clean and crisp end.
